Study on the performance of the glass fiber reinforced-machine-made sand concrete
In order to solve the problem of unstable performance and easy shrinkage and cracking of machine-made sand,it proposed the use of corrosion-resistant glass fibers to strengthen mechanical sand concrete.It designed 180 glass fiber reinforced-machine-made sand concrete specimens with different mix ratios,conducted slump tests,axial compressive strength tests,flexural strength tests and shrinkage tests.The influence and the impact principles of the substitution rate of machine-made sand and the content of glass fiber,on the work ability,mechanical properties,and shrinkage performance of glass fiber reinforced machine-made sand concrete was compared.The optimal substitution rate of machine-made sand for natural sand and the optimal dosage of glass fiber were obtained.Make an effort to promote the development and application of the glass fiber reinforced machine-made concrete sand.
